An aqueous phosphoric acid solution prepared by diluting 200 ml of phosphoric acid solution in a concentration of 14 moles/liter by adding water to make up a volume of 500 ml was introduced into a three-necked flask of 1 liter capacity and heated and kept at 90° C. An aqueous solution of cerium (IV) sulfate, which was prepared separately by dissolving 22.9 g of a reagent-grade cerium (IV) sulfate monohydrate having a purity of 95% in 500 ml of water with admixture of 16 ml of a 18 moles/liter aqueous solution of sulfuric acid, was added dropwise into the aqueous phosphoric acid solution under agitation at a rate of 4 ml per minute so that precipitates were formed in the mixture. After completion of the dropwise addition of the cerium sulfate solution, the mixture in the flask was agitated for further 8 hours by keeping the temperature at 90° C. followed by filtration to collect the precipitates which were thoroughly washed with water and dried at room temperature.
